2002-10-21PHL-2002-L-67377
Philippines
Nursing personnel
 
Philippine Nursing Act, 2002 (Act No. 9173).
Official Gazette, 2003-01-20, Vol. 99, No. 3, pp. 336-344
Act on-line, The LawPhil Project, Philippine Laws and Jursiprudence Databank, Arellano Law Foundation (consulted on 2009-01-16)
Act on-line, The LawPhil Project, Philippine Laws and Jursiprudence Databank, Arellano Law Foundation (consulted on 2009-01-16)

Comprehensive legislation regulating various aspects of nursing profession. Main objective is to provide for protection and improvement of nursing profession by instituting measures that shall result in relevant nursing education, humane working conditions, better career prospects and dignified existence for nurses. Inter alia provides for organisation of board of nursing, examination and registration of nurses, nursing education, nursing practice, as well as several related matters. Repeals Nursing Act, 1991.




1992-03-26PHL-1992-L-77599
Philippines
Nursing personnel
 
The Magna Carta of Public Health Workers (Republic Act No. 7305).
English translation, Chan Robles Virtual Law Library, Philippines (consulted on 2008-01-28)

Provides for the recruitment, qualifications and working conditions of persons working in the health sector.




1985-11-25PHL-1985-R-2425
Philippines
Nursing personnel
 
Board of Nursing Resolution No. 1903 adopting the rules governing continuing professional education accreditation programme for nurse practitioners.
Official Gazette, 1985-12-16, N. 50, pp. 5903-5907

Adopted under the Philippine Nursing Law Act No. 877.
